アニメーションもcssでやる時代

Author:

どうしてもタイマーで画像が更新されるとかいう処理を考えるとJavaScriptで実装、となりがちであるが、最近ではcssで十分描画できてしまうのだ。
transitionでどれをどの時間で変えるか設定して、animationでキーフレームを設定するだけ。
マウスオーバーとか時間で遷移なんてものはこれで十分である。
クリックイベントなんか使わないかぎりjQueryに出番は無いのである。

Continue reading…

エンジニア界隈で使われているエディタ

Author:

プログラマーってのはプログラムを書くのが仕事なわけで、エディタとは切っても切れない関係です。
ってわけで今まで共に仕事してきた人達がどんなエディタを使っていたをまとめてみようと思います。

Continue reading…

.netは特に名前空間に注意して

Author:

C#とかオブジェクト志向言語は名前空間が違うけど同じ名前のクラスがいたりする。
最近.net少しやっているのだが、TreeViewってのがSystem.Windows.FormとSystem.Web.UI.WebControlsという2つの名前空間に存在していて、うっかりMSDNを見間違えていた。
前者は.net Frameworkで使う通常のWindowsFormアプリ用、後者はASP.netとかXamarinとかで使うWebアプリ用。
ああ紛らわしい。ネットで調べていてもあちこちでambiguousとか言われているしね。
ってことで、オブジェクト志向言語のリファレンス見る時は名前空間を意識しましょう。

Continue reading…

分かりにくい変数名でも良いからスペルミスだけはやめてくれ

Author:

プログラムにおいて変数名ってのは色々と悩みどころである。
だから英文として意味がおかしいのはまあしょうがないところもある。

が、スペルミスはやめようよ。
カッコ悪いし、知識レベルを疑われてしまう。
そして下手したらそれがずっと残ってしまう。

Continue reading…

エンジニアが持っていると便利な能力

Author:

学生さんとかの中には、4月から新社会人の人もいるかと思います。
本日はこの春からエンジニアとかプログラマーとして就職する人のために、エンジニアにあると便利な能力をいくつかピックアップしてみましょう。

Continue reading…

エンジニアはアイデアを形にできるという誇りをもったほうがいい

Author:

けっこう当たり前に使っていると忘れがちなのですが、
僕らエンジニアはプログラムを組むことができます。

プログラムを書くことによって、様々なことができます。
エンジニアは0から1を創りだすことができる。

それって何気に誇りにできる事なのですよねえ。

Continue reading…

初めてプログラムを学ぶならJavaScriptがおすすめ

Author:

ブラックだとかキツイとか言われがちな事もあって、
プログラマーの世界は比較的就職しやすい世界だったりするのですよね。

興味ない人はどうしても拒否反応を起こしてしまうのですけど
プログラムをやってみたい、という人はどの言語から始めたらいいのか。

僕が思うに、一番手軽に始められるのはJavaScriptじゃないかなーと思うのですよ。

Continue reading…